Afropop singer Yemi Alade has released her seventh studio album, titled “It’s Yemi Alade”.
The 16-track album, released on Friday, features collaborations with Ferré Gola, Don Jazzy, Singuila, Jeriq and Kenyan artistes Bien, Sofiya Nzau and Njerae.
The project is Alade’s 10th body of work and continues her tradition of bringing together different African sounds and artistes.
Alade had earlier announced the album’s release on Instagram, revealing that the title was chosen by her fans.
“The Album, OUT SEPTEMBER 11TH. I remember when you all made album title suggestions and ‘It’s Yemi Alade’ had the highest votes, and now THE ALBUM is about to be yours,” she said.
The album’s rollout included the release of “Ala Bekee”, accompanied by a comic video featuring Don Jazzy, Destiny Etiko and Nosa Rex.
The video centres on a pre-wedding photoshoot that turns into a playful rivalry between Alade and Don Jazzy.
The album also features three Kenyan artistes, Bien, Sofiya Nzau and Njerae, further highlighting collaborations between Nigerian and East African musicians.
The release follows a busy period for Alade, who received a solo Grammy nomination, appeared on the cover of Forbes Africa and released songs including “Worry”, “My Padi” and “Mbali”.
She has also expanded her activities into the beauty industry with the launch of her cosmetics line, Yem Beauty.
